Medart is an unincorporated community in Wakulla County, Florida, United States. [1]

History

James Wolf Smith, born in Pawtucket, in 1813, was the first recorded settler of the area, moving in the area of Medart in 1848. His plantation, initially called Pawtuxet, later became the community of Medart. [2]
